Mr McGregor’s Garden cross stitch pattern is a replica of Beatrix Potter’s drawing of Peter Rabbit squeezing into Mr McGregor’s vegetable patch. And in his blue coat with brass buttons!
The Project
This is NOT full coverage cross stitch so you’ll only be stitching the naughty Peter Rabbit disobeying his mother and getting into Mr McGregor’s garden.
The finished piece measures 26.5cm x 28.7cm when stitched on 14 count Aida cloth, but you’ll only be completing 15,499 stitches. The pattern works perfectly with Pattern Keeper App and there are NO backstitches.
